What are the different types of Selective Invoice Finance for Media Production Companies?

Spot Factoring

Finance for individual invoices, chosen as needed.

Spot Factoring

Spot factoring lets media companies sell individual invoices to a finance provider for immediate cash, rather than committing their whole sales ledger, offering flexibility to manage specific project-related cash flow gaps.

Single Invoice Discounting

Advance cash on a single invoice without full ledger commitment.

Single Invoice Discounting

Single invoice discounting provides immediate funds against a single chosen invoice. The company retains control over collections, making it discreet and suitable for production companies with occasional cash flow needs.

Selective Receivables Finance

Choose which customer invoices to finance for flexible cash flow.

Selective Receivables Finance

Selective receivables finance allows media companies to finance chosen invoices from selected clients, offering greater control and flexibility, especially useful for irregular or project-based income streams in media production.

What is Selective Invoice Finance for Media Production Companies?

Flexible Cash Flow Management

Selective Invoice Finance allows media production companies to choose specific customer invoices to finance, providing immediate access to cash for ongoing projects and expenses without needing to finance their entire sales ledger.

Control and Cost Efficiency

Unlike traditional invoice finance options, this solution offers the freedom to decide which invoices to finance and when, so companies aren't tied into lengthy contracts and can use the service only when needed.

Control and Cost Efficiency

Businesses only pay for the invoices they choose to finance, helping them control costs. The process also allows them to keep client relationships private, as customers rarely deal directly with the finance provider.
